Budget

$334,112 spent so far of the $361,065 originally approved (94% of the current budget drawn). Still in progress, so this is neither over nor under.

Council later reduced the budget by $5,025 to $356,040 (-1%).

94% of the current budget has been drawn.

Originally approved by Council$361,065
Change since approval-$5,025
Current budget$356,040
Spent to date$334,112
Against the original approval$26,953 not yet spent — still in progress

Source: capital financial statement, document 15221, page 6. These figures were parsed from that document and reconciled against the totals it states.
